West Ham United vs Arsenal Match Preview


In a weekend match on Sunday May 1st, in week 35, Arsenal will travel to London to battle West Ham United in a Premier League match in the ever popular London derby. The game day is forecasted to be a cloudy and cool day, with daytime temperatures of only 14 degrees, which is great football weather. In their last match, 7th placed West Ham United, recorded a 0-1 loss against Chelsea. Christian Pulišić scored the first goal for Chelsea in the 90th minute, and with that single goal the scoring was complete. Neither team could manage anything else In the end, West Ham United couldn’t muster any offence and Chelsea ran away with the shutout win. West Ham United is looking for direction having 3 win and 4 losses in their last 10 matches, while in their last match, 4th placed Arsenal, recorded a 3-1 win against Manchester United. Nuno Tavares scored the first goal for Arsenal in the 3rd minute, then Bukayo Saka added another in the 32nd minute on a penalty kick. With 18 points in their last 10 matches Arsenal should be reasonably happy with their performance.

In their last match together, Arsenal was victorious by a score of 2 to 0 in front of almost 60000 jubilant fans. Martinelli struck first for Arsenal in the 48th minute on a feed from Alexandre Lacazette, then Emile Smith Rowe added another in the 87th minute on a feed from Bukayo Saka In the end, West Ham United couldn’t muster any offence and Arsenal ran away with the shutout win.

Arsenal is lucky enough to have a few offensive weapons, with Edward Nketiah and Bukayo Saka each having 2 goals in their last five. Jarrod Bowen has been the most effective weapon for West Ham United lately. The English attacker has netted two goals in his last five matches

West Ham United will be without Issa Diop and Angelo Ogbonna, while Kieran Tierney is unavailable to play for Arsenal.
